The line graph depicts the link between age and criminality rate last year ,whilst the pie chart showcases the percentage of numerous kinds of crimes during the same year. Overall, the majroity of criminals are youngsters and a large portion of this phenomenon features violence. It is conspicuous that young people are the prime lawbreakers in the british society. In fact, according to the data, individuals who are 20 are responsible for 80% of crimes. It is also noticeable that there is no criminal under the age of 8 years old. Hence, criminality starts from this period. Furthermore, the crime rate decreases dramatically from the age of 20 to 28 years old, passing from 80% to exactly 20%. Afterwards, it plummets steadily until becoming under the 10% at the age of 60. On the other hand, the pie chart puts forward the fact that violent acts are the most that occured. Indeed, this genre of detrimental action accounts for 46%, followed by property crimes that represent 23% of the total. Then, 22% of crimes that occured the previous year were related to narcotics. Finally, public order crime accounts only for 9%.
